See Point Research (CPR) recently reviewed multiple preferred relationship applications with well over ten million packages combined in order to recognize how safe he or she is to own profiles. Once the relationships apps usually use geolocation investigation, offering the chance to connect with some one close, it convenience function tend to comes at a price. The search centers around a certain software entitled Hornet which had vulnerabilities, making it possible for the precise located area of the associate, which gift suggestions a major privacy chance to help you the pages.
Key Ends
- Procedure such as for instance trilateration enable it to be attackers to determine user coordinates using range information
- Even with safety measures, the newest Hornet relationships software a popular gay dating app with over 10 billion downloads had weaknesses, enabling precise venue determination, even though pages disabled the brand new display screen of their ranges. We establish a technique that welcome us to reach venue accuracy contained in this 10 yards inside the reproducible experiments
- The fresh new Hornet designers provides accompanied the new strategies to reduce danger, having led to a reduction in area accuracy in order to fifty m.
Assessment
CPR found that the Hornet app sends particular coordinates to your host. Hornet’s founders are aware of the problems of member placement, as mentioned on their website. Nonetheless, it is said to guard associate towns and cities from the randomizing the length presented from the software, so it’s, within their viewpoint, impossible to determine the specific venue. However, this isn’t possible.
At the time of our search, the actions drawn by Hornet had been insufficient to guard affiliate coordinates, making it possible for brand new dedication out of representative towns and cities with extremely high accuracy.
Adopting the in control disclosure procedure, i made an effort to contact new Hornet people, going for the outcomes your research. In advance of it publication, we reexamined brand new Hornet app. Even after not receiving a reaction to all of our inquiry, Glance at Part Look can also be confirm that the new builders have already observed expected strategies so you can rather reduce the precision of users’ accentuate determination. Because specified in control revelation deadlines has passed, our company is posting the outcome your browse.
Information Geolocation & It is possible to Risks:
Geolocation try an occurrence using investigation acquired of your measuring tool (such as for example a smartphone, tablet, or computer) to determine or imagine the real-world geographical location of these unit. This short article can vary off extremely accurate venue information (such as for example a certain address otherwise location coordinates) derived thanks to GPS (Global positioning system) to less precise venue research acquired via Internet protocol address, Wi-Fi, cellular communities, otherwise Wireless beacons.
Geolocation technical, if you’re beneficial, presents several threats, particularly when considering privacy and you may cover contained in this apps. They have been potential confidentiality breaches out of unauthorized studies supply, unintended revealing away from place study with third-group entities, dangers of recording and surveillance, and you can shelter vulnerabilities particularly place spoofing. This particular article is taken advantage of from the stalkers, crooks, or any other harmful stars.
Strategy having choosing point
Inside Hornet and similar programs, users on the search results try sorted for the rising acquisition from length. If we look for one or two pages about google search results which ensure it is the newest display of their length, while the target user is found between them in the search results, we can determine the newest calculate length to your address user because the typical property value several recognized ranges:
Although not, the clear presence of profiles around the target isnt an important standing. To search for the range for the member, its required to check in an additional membership, the fresh new coordinates at which can be regulated.
You could potentially determine the distance between a couple of users by iteratively separating the product range by 50 percent and you may placement an additional account at the midpoint. Because of the taking a look at the fresh search results and you may refining the look considering the presence of the goal associate, progressively narrowing on the range involving the target therefore the even more account, we can reach the desired accuracy.
Trilateration strategy
I made use of one or two-action trilateration: very first, we performed trilateration having fun with a couple of reference things to receive several possible candidate places (intersection things of your own circles). Up coming, i used the length pointers regarding the third site suggest discover right service.
Making the assumption that we know the space where target membership can be found, that have a great diameter out of 10 kilometres. Like, this might be a tiny urban area. With this city, i at random made 29 sets of reference activities inside the a band with an interior radius of five kilometres and you may an outer radius out of ten kilometer.
Down seriously to trilateration per band of site circumstances, we acquired some possible coordinates to the address section. Maximum mistake in geolocation was 350 yards, while the minimal was only dos m. I calculated the latest indicate value of latitude and you may longitude for everyone items. The length between your suggest value and also the target part appeared become 24 meters.
Boosting geolocation precision
Being able to influence the fresh calculate area, i made site points far away of just one to dos miles in the part where the address try allowed to be discover. Implementing the means, we acquired of a lot quotes of the address location. The newest geolocation errors was indeed marketed nearly equally, of at least step 1.5 yards and you will all in all, 70 yards. We together with calculated the average latitude and longitude for the performance. The fresh new resulting average section is actually less than 5 m of the mark section:
Conclusion
Regarding dating apps, bringing in representative geolocation poses high threats so you’re able to confidentiality asianmelodies. Our very own studies found prospective vulnerabilities regarding the Hornet matchmaking application, that has more ten mil packages. The fresh put up point quote methodology, in conjunction with trilateration using a large number of resource products, showed a very high accuracy for the deciding representative cities.
Hornet builders applied changes to mitigate the dangers, reducing the venue reliability in order to 50 yards. That it update, whenever you are extreme, still allows an empowered assailant to choose approximate coordinates.
CPR firmly recommends pages is vigilant towards permissions they grant so you’re able to programs in order to stay advised concerning the perils and greatest techniques to possess protecting confidentiality and you will coverage whenever talking about geolocation investigation. By disabling location functions, profiles can possibly prevent software off recording its whereabouts and you may event suggestions regarding their motions. So it measure can be effortlessly protect user confidentiality and circumvent the newest discussing of personal data which have additional organizations.